Originally Posted By: Jimmy--h---ton
This video was great! But can you recommend what line to use as backing?

I guess braid. imma see what i have laying around and might back with 20lb all the way to 65lb just depends on what sizes i have collecting dust. I have been using cheap mono for years. Only reason i backed was to cut down on the amount of Floro i wasted. Never even thought about doing it to improve casting like Aaron Martins video talks about
